Tora If you are using an H&E it was vertually impossible in our hands to try to threshold fiber area. We worked with Image Pro Plus for about 6 months trying to get this to work and we could not, we ended up creating an algorithm in image pro that allowed us to trace the fibers and that would calculate fiber area and diameter, etc.
